Is it permissible to place the Mushaf on the ground for prostration when reciting an verse that contains a prostration, or must it be raised to an elevated place?

There is no harm in placing the Mus'haf (Qur'an) on a pure ground when prostrating for recitation (sajdat at-tilawah). However, if it is possible to place it in a raised position or hand it to someone next to you, that would be better, out of reverence for it and to avoid any misgivings.
